Original Description
Henry Charles Fox’s Horses Pulling Cart Watering in a River by a Rural Village is a charming pastoral scene that captures the serene rhythm of rural life in the 19th century. The painting depicts a pair of sturdy horses watering in a shallow river while pulling a wooden cart, set against the backdrop of a quaint village. Light dances on the water’s surface, and the soft, natural hues of the landscape evoke a sense of tranquility and timeless simplicity. Fox, a British painter active in the late 19th to early 20th century, was known for his detailed genre scenes and animal studies, often reflecting rural traditions. His style blends realism with a gentle romanticism, reminiscent of the Victorian pastoral tradition. While not as widely recognized as his contemporaries, Fox’s works offer a valuable glimpse into rural idylls and the harmonious relationship between humans, animals, and nature. This piece, with its meticulous brushwork and atmospheric depth, serves as a delightful representation of pastoral aesthetics in British art.
